
Tire Pressure Monitoring System Market is poised for significant growth, expected to increase from $3.5 billion in 2024 to $6.8 billion by 2034, at a robust CAGR of 6.9%. This growth is fueled by a surge in vehicle safety awareness, rising automotive production, and stricter regulatory standards mandating the inclusion of TPMS in new vehicles. TPMS technology plays a pivotal role in automotive safety by providing real-time information on tire pressure, thereby reducing accident risks, improving fuel efficiency, and prolonging tire life.
Comprising both direct and indirect systems, the market serves original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) as well as the aftermarket sector. The direct TPMS segment leads with approximately 65% market share, favored for its accuracy and real-time monitoring capabilities. Indirect TPMS, although less precise, is gaining traction due to its affordability and integration simplicity, especially in cost-sensitive markets.

Market Dynamics
Several factors are driving the TPMS market forward. At the core is the increasing enforcement of government regulations such as the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) in the U.S. and the EU directive requiring TPMS in all new vehicles. These mandates have positioned TPMS as a standard feature, rather than a luxury add-on.
Consumer demand is also evolving, with heightened awareness about the benefits of correct tire pressure—such as improved vehicle handling, lower emissions, and better fuel economy. Additionally, the rise of electric vehicles (EVs) and connected car technologies has opened new avenues for TPMS innovation, integrating it with adv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) and telematics.
However, challenges persist. High costs of advanced systems and integration complexities with vehicle electronics can hinder adoption in developing economies. Short product life cycles, driven by rapid technological changes, also place pressure on manufacturers to constantly innovate.

Regional Analysis
North America currently leads the global TPMS market, driven by strict regulatory requirements, high vehicle ownership rates, and a mature automotive industry. The U.S., in particular, remains a dominant player due to federal mandates and a strong focus on road safety.
Europe follows closely, with countries like Germany and France enforcing comprehensive safety standards. The EU’s proactive legislation has significantly boosted TPMS adoption, especially in the passenger vehicle segment.
Asia Pacific is emerging as the next growth engine, propelled by increasing urbanization, rising disposable incomes, and growing vehicle sales in China and India. These markets are also experiencing a shift toward premium features in vehicles, including TPMS.
Latin America and the Middle East & Africa present modest but promising opportunities. Brazil, for example, is making strides in automotive safety, while GCC countries are gradually embracing vehicle safety norms amid growing consumer awareness.
Recent News & Developments
The TPMS industry is undergoing rapid transformation, shaped by technology convergence and changing market needs. Recent trends include the integration of TPMS with ADAS and connected car platforms. Manufacturers are developing energy-efficient and environmentally friendly solutions, responding to global sustainability concerns.
Geopolitical tensions and supply chain disruptions have impacted the availability and pricing of key components. In response, manufacturers are localizing supply chains and exploring alternative materials to ensure product continuity and affordability.
Pricing remains variable, ranging between $30 and $150 per unit, depending on technology and brand. The aftermarket sector continues to grow, offering retrofitting options for older vehicles.
